Tabnine Logo
DataStoreIdColumn
Code IndexAdd Tabnine to your IDE (free)

How to use
DataStoreIdColumn
in
org.apache.openjpa.persistence.jdbc

Best Java code snippets using org.apache.openjpa.persistence.jdbc.DataStoreIdColumn (Showing top 4 results out of 315)

origin: org.apache.openjpa/com.springsource.org.apache.openjpa

/**
 * Parse datastore identity information in @DataStoreIdColumn.
 */
private void parseDataStoreIdColumn(ClassMapping cm, DataStoreIdColumn id) {
  Column col = new Column();
  if (!StringUtils.isEmpty(id.name()))
    col.setName(id.name());
  if (!StringUtils.isEmpty(id.columnDefinition()))
    col.setTypeName(id.columnDefinition());
  if (id.precision() != 0)
    col.setSize(id.precision());
  col.setFlag(Column.FLAG_UNINSERTABLE, !id.insertable());
  col.setFlag(Column.FLAG_UNUPDATABLE, !id.updatable());
  cm.getMappingInfo().setColumns(Arrays.asList(new Column[]{ col }));
}
origin: org.apache.openejb.patch/openjpa

/**
 * Parse datastore identity information in @DataStoreIdColumn.
 */
private void parseDataStoreIdColumn(ClassMapping cm, DataStoreIdColumn id) {
  Column col = new Column();
  if (!StringUtils.isEmpty(id.name()))
    col.setIdentifier(DBIdentifier.newColumn(id.name(), delimit()));
  if (!StringUtils.isEmpty(id.columnDefinition()))
    col.setTypeIdentifier(DBIdentifier.newColumnDefinition(id.columnDefinition()));
  if (id.precision() != 0)
    col.setSize(id.precision());
  col.setFlag(Column.FLAG_UNINSERTABLE, !id.insertable());
  col.setFlag(Column.FLAG_UNUPDATABLE, !id.updatable());
  cm.getMappingInfo().setColumns(Arrays.asList(new Column[]{ col }));
}

origin: org.apache.openjpa/openjpa-persistence-jdbc

/**
 * Parse datastore identity information in @DataStoreIdColumn.
 */
private void parseDataStoreIdColumn(ClassMapping cm, DataStoreIdColumn id) {
  Column col = new Column();
  if (!StringUtil.isEmpty(id.name()))
    col.setIdentifier(DBIdentifier.newColumn(id.name(), delimit()));
  if (!StringUtil.isEmpty(id.columnDefinition()))
    col.setTypeIdentifier(DBIdentifier.newColumnDefinition(id.columnDefinition()));
  if (id.precision() != 0)
    col.setSize(id.precision());
  col.setFlag(Column.FLAG_UNINSERTABLE, !id.insertable());
  col.setFlag(Column.FLAG_UNUPDATABLE, !id.updatable());
  cm.getMappingInfo().setColumns(Arrays.asList(new Column[]{ col }));
}

origin: org.apache.openjpa/openjpa-all

/**
 * Parse datastore identity information in @DataStoreIdColumn.
 */
private void parseDataStoreIdColumn(ClassMapping cm, DataStoreIdColumn id) {
  Column col = new Column();
  if (!StringUtil.isEmpty(id.name()))
    col.setIdentifier(DBIdentifier.newColumn(id.name(), delimit()));
  if (!StringUtil.isEmpty(id.columnDefinition()))
    col.setTypeIdentifier(DBIdentifier.newColumnDefinition(id.columnDefinition()));
  if (id.precision() != 0)
    col.setSize(id.precision());
  col.setFlag(Column.FLAG_UNINSERTABLE, !id.insertable());
  col.setFlag(Column.FLAG_UNUPDATABLE, !id.updatable());
  cm.getMappingInfo().setColumns(Arrays.asList(new Column[]{ col }));
}

org.apache.openjpa.persistence.jdbcDataStoreIdColumn

Most used methods

  • columnDefinition
  • insertable
  • name
  • precision
  • updatable

Popular in Java

  • Reading from database using SQL prepared statement
  • setContentView (Activity)
  • orElseThrow (Optional)
    Return the contained value, if present, otherwise throw an exception to be created by the provided s
  • putExtra (Intent)
  • File (java.io)
    An "abstract" representation of a file system entity identified by a pathname. The pathname may be a
  • FileOutputStream (java.io)
    An output stream that writes bytes to a file. If the output file exists, it can be replaced or appen
  • InetAddress (java.net)
    An Internet Protocol (IP) address. This can be either an IPv4 address or an IPv6 address, and in pra
  • MessageDigest (java.security)
    Uses a one-way hash function to turn an arbitrary number of bytes into a fixed-length byte sequence.
  • Arrays (java.util)
    This class contains various methods for manipulating arrays (such as sorting and searching). This cl
  • Vector (java.util)
    Vector is an implementation of List, backed by an array and synchronized. All optional operations in
  • Top plugins for Android Studio
Tabnine Logo
  • Products

    Search for Java codeSearch for JavaScript code
  • IDE Plugins

    IntelliJ IDEAWebStormVisual StudioAndroid StudioEclipseVisual Studio CodePyCharmSublime TextPhpStormVimGoLandRubyMineEmacsJupyter NotebookJupyter LabRiderDataGripAppCode
  • Company

    About UsContact UsCareers
  • Resources

    FAQBlogTabnine AcademyTerms of usePrivacy policyJava Code IndexJavascript Code Index
Get Tabnine for your IDE now